In the last netball match of the term, we are delighted to confirm that our U16A squad won their round of the Sisters n Sport competition to progress through to the Quarter Finals in January.
After a slower start in the match our WHS netballers composed themselves to win all quarters and beat North London Collegiate School 27-13.
We travel to Roedean School in Sussex for our quarter final match.
We were so pleased to hear that Agnes was selected to be part of Team GB this year, here is a report from her competitions:
After selection I attended an international Cadet U17 competition in Klagenfurt. I came 81st out of 300 but I was annoyed by my final bout, fencing against an Italian athlete - I knew I could do better!
Two weeks ago, I also competed at a national Cadet competition where I came 5th so I was very happy with this result.
